Formation of Cr-Zr gradient layer by magnetron sputtering and ion mixing

The gradient Cr-Zr layer was formed onto Zr-1Nb substrate by magnetron sputtering of chromium and zirconium targets and ion mixing (Ar+ with 25 keV). The distribution of Cr and Zr elements in the deposited coatings was measured by using a glow discharge optical emission spectroscopy. The optimal ion fluence onto the substrate was 8×1019 ion/m2. At higher ion dose, the intensive sputtering of the deposited coating was observed.
